In this episode of the Work Unravelled podcast, we explore the importance of establishing an effective morning routine to enhance work-life balance and productivity. 

We discuss:

✔️ Dismantling the myth of the '5:00 AM club' and advocating for personalised routines that suit individual needs. 

✔️ The significance of taking time at the start of the day for reflection and planning

✔️ The idea of conducting high-energy tasks like 'eating the frog' early in the morning

✔️ The benefits of time boxing and walking meetings. 

✔️ Actionable tips for setting a positive tone and managing your time effectively to enhance productivity and team dynamics.
